I have already gotten some advice on this at the Morelia forum but am still uncertain as to what to do. I have an 8'plus Carpet Python who loves to perch. I am trying to install some large natural perching tree branches for her. Any suggestions? At this point I figure I will just screw them directly in to the sides of the cage. These branches are heavy and I don't want them falling on the animal.
